Ssann Basz is a Japanese electro-industrial band with Sanabu on vocals and lyrics, Baza on bass and electronics, and Saikai on guitar, keyboards, and sound engineering. They operate from the underground, working with themes that lean toward the darker side of things. Their 2018 remix of Blackpink's "Ddu-Du Ddu-Du" gives a sense of their approach, with Sanabu's vocals layered over driving basslines and electronic manipulation.
Their albums include "Nocturnal" from 2020 and "Psychotic" from 2022. The music tends to be raw and confrontational, which has drawn both fans and critics over time. They haven't chased mainstream recognition, staying instead with the experimental edges of their sound.
